All URIs are relative to https://api.sportsdata.io/v3/wnba/scores
Method | HTTP request | Description |
---|---|---|
are_games_in_progress | GET /{format}/AreAnyGamesInProgress | Are Games In Progress |
current_season | GET /{format}/CurrentSeason | Current Season |
games_by_date | GET /{format}/GamesByDate/{date} | Games by Date |
schedule | GET /{format}/Games/{Season} | Schedule |
stadiums | GET /{format}/Stadiums | Stadiums |
teams | GET /{format}/Teams | Teams |
bool are_games_in_progress(format)
Are Games In Progress
from __future__ import print_function
import time
import sportsdata.wnba_scores
from sportsdata.wnba_scores.rest import ApiException
from pprint import pprint
# Configure API key authorization: apiKeyHeader
configuration = sportsdata.wnba_scores.Configuration()
configuration.api_key['Ocp-Apim-Subscription-Key'] = 'YOUR_API_KEY'
# Uncomment below to setup prefix (e.g. Bearer) for API key, if needed
# configuration.api_key_prefix['Ocp-Apim-Subscription-Key'] = 'Bearer'
# Configure API key authorization: apiKeyQuery
configuration = sportsdata.wnba_scores.Configuration()
configuration.api_key['subscription-key'] = 'YOUR_API_KEY'
# Uncomment below to setup prefix (e.g. Bearer) for API key, if needed
# configuration.api_key_prefix['subscription-key'] = 'Bearer'
# create an instance of the API class
api_instance = sportsdata.wnba_scores.DefaultApi(sportsdata.wnba_scores.ApiClient(configuration))
format = 'format_example' # str | Desired response format. Valid entries are <code>XML</code> or <code>JSON</code>.
try:
# Are Games In Progress
api_response = api_instance.are_games_in_progress(format)
pprint(api_response)
except ApiException as e:
print("Exception when calling DefaultApi->are_games_in_progress: %s\n" % e)
Name | Type | Description | Notes |
---|---|---|---|
format | str | Desired response format. Valid entries are <code>XML</code> or <code>JSON</code>. |
bool
- Content-Type: Not defined
- Accept: application/json
